If we were an RPG character, our main stat would be endurance.
We are, by animal standards, hellishly undying and unrelenting terrors, these Terminator-esque nightmares that just DO. NOT. STOP.
So ancestrally we are persistence hunters. That is, our main tactic for catching prey without fancy weapons was to just run them down, especially in our way-back home of the African desert. You can still see it, all over the human body.
We are nearly hairless. This lack of insulation means better heat dissipation. We have a *ton* of sweat glands, next to other mammals. Again, heat dissipation. Another one is our two-legged gait - walking for us is technically just a series of controlled falls. We let gravity do half the work, and as a result use up fewer resources and generate less heat (quadrupeds, on the other hand, have to do more work with more legs).

There are many aspects of being a human that makes us unique to other creatures, so we consulted Live Science to see what they think the top 10 traits that make humans special are. First, they mention our speech as a unique characteristic of humans. They explain that essentially, the size of our brains makes it possible for us to have a wide vocal range and precise control over our vocalizations. “In simple terms, primates with bigger cortical association areas tended to make more sounds," says Jacob Dunn, an associate professor of evolutionary biology at Anglia Ruskin University. This special feature has allowed our species to develop over 7,000 different languages.
The fact that we walk on two legs is also unique compared to many species. Having our hands free while walking makes us capable of doing multiple things at once, like using tools (or let's be honest, texting and walking). However, Live Science notes that there are downsides to this trait as well. The way our bodies evolved to walk upright has made human birth particularly dangerous compared to many other animals. Our pelvises are not made for pushing out babies with large brains, and the lumbar curve in our spines makes us prone to developing back pain.

Not quite the case. They're called myoclonic jerks. When you're asleep, the "clutch" is disengaged, and you can dream to your heart's content without moving. EEG and fMRI studies show the motor cortex (that controls movement) is active, but the connection is temporarily turned off. A myoclonic jerk is sort of like "popping the clutch." The opposite is a condition known as sleep paralysis. You wake up, and can breathe, but otherwise not move. It's another of the "parasomnias"

Breastmilk will produce antibodies to help baby fight off disease. It’s thought that’s babies saliva enters the nipple, mums body tests for any undesirable bacteria, then produces milk to help fight it off.
For this reason, it’s not unusual for breastmilk to look different when baby is sick. Sometimes very dark yellow and thick, almost like colostrum. It also contains different hormones depending on the time of day, and is antibacterial. It is a living liquid
Compared to most other mammals, humans are also relatively hairless. I know what you might be thinking, your husband has the hairiest back you have ever seen or you believe that your legs are covered in fur. But if you compare yourself to a bear or a chimpanzee, you might be feeling smooth as silk. We used to have much more body hair, but apparently, about 2 million years ago, an adaptation caused our body hair to “miniaturize”, while another adaptation caused us to have many more sweat glands than most other mammals. Today, these adaptations make it much easier for us to cool off. Archaeologist here.
You can give birth after you've died.
Occasionally we will come across a really confronting burial where the skeleton of an unborn child is halfway through its mothers pelvis. Generally what happens is the woman has died before giving birth and after burial a build up of gasses from decomposition forces the baby out. We refer to this as "coffin birth".

One of the most special things about the human body is our famously overdeveloped cerebral cortex. It makes up over 80% of our brain’s mass and allows us to use complex, higher level thinking skills, such as making decisions, executive control, emotional regulation and using speech. Our amazing brains are responsible for only 2% of our total body weight, but they use up more than a quarter of our body’s energy. And although we don’t have the largest brains in the world, that would be sperm whales with brains weighing up to 20 pounds or 9 kilograms, we do have the most impressive brains. The bone that supports your eyeball, called the orbital floor, is paper thin and has a large empty cavity, called the maxillary sinus, on the opposite side. When you get hit hard in the eyeball, instead of your eyeball itself rupturing, the bone underneath your eye breaks, which is called an orbital floor fracture. This releases the pressure from the impact and saves your eyeball. If you crush a beachball against a concrete wall, you can pop it, but if you try crush it against a styrofoam wall, the wall breaks but the beachball is fine. An amazing evolutionary adaptation to protect your eyesight.

Another feature of the human body you might want to give yourself a hand for developing is, well, your hands. We may not be the only species that has opposable thumbs, as most primates do, but our thumbs are particularly large. It is unique that we can bring our thumbs all the way across the palm of our hands, which makes it much easier for us to pick up objects than most other primates. We also have impressive muscle control in our hands, allowing us to write precisely, play sports with accuracy, provide excellent massages and create amazing visual art. The ability to blush is also a uniquely human characteristic. Darwin referred to blushing as “the most peculiar and the most human of all expressions”, but perhaps he never had someone tell his crush that he liked them in middle school. Nothing peculiar about the reaction of blushing then; it felt like a perfectly appropriate response in my opinion… But there is a theory that blushing was developed as an evolutionary response to acknowledge a mistake or embarrassment without having to address it verbally. “A prerequisite for embarrassment is to be able to feel how others feel — you have to be empathetic, intelligent to the social situation," says Ray Crozier, an honorary professor at Cardiff University’s School of Social Sciences. If the person you’re talking to can see that you are clearly aware of your mistake, there is no need to bring it up. Something else that is fascinating about being a human is our long childhoods. While some other species have long lifespans like Asian elephants and blue-and-gold macaws, we are special in the way that it takes us so long to mature. Our childhoods are twice as long as chimpanzees, and even earlier versions of humans reached adulthood faster than we do today. There are several possible explanations for this, including the size of our brains and our long lifespans.
According to Associate Professor of Psychology Suzana Herculano-Houzel at Vanderbilt University, “It makes sense that the more neurons you have in the cortex, the longer it should take a species to reach that point where it's not only physiologically mature, but also mentally capable of being independent. The delay also gives those species with more cortical neurons more time to learn from experience, as they interact with the environment." The microscopic mites living on your face feeding off the oil glands.
You can't see them, but they're there. They are microscopic mites, eight-legged creatures rather like spiders. Almost every human being has them. They spend their entire lives on our faces, where they eat, mate and finally die.
There are two species of mite that live on your face: Demodex folliculorum and D. brevis.

When you first set your sight on the seconds of a watch (or anything with a rapid regular movement) you will sometimes feel like the first second lasts a little bit too long. It's because your brain replaces the motion blur that happens when you moved your sight from wherever it was to the watch with a fixed image.
And the cool thing is that it replaces it "after the fact", or rather gives you a very short false memory that you were already watching the watch while your eyes were moving, making that first second seem longer.
It's called Chronostasis.

When you're a baby you have several defence mechanisms that stop you from drowning: you reflexively hold your breath when underwater and your heart rate and consumption of oxygen decreases, allowing you to last significantly longer underwater than an adult.
That automatic breath holding is called the Mammalian Dive Reflex (MDR).

Cutting the corpus callosum ( connects two brain hemispheres) can produce some freaky results. Such as your hand doing s**t that your conscious mind isn't aware of, writing a sentence or scratching an itch without knowing for instance.
There was a case where this was done to treat severe epilepsy. After the person reported they would be buttoning their shirt and the other hand would be unbuttoning it at the same time.

There is a muscle, called palmaris longus, in the forearm missing in about 10% of the population. You can easy test if you have it by putting your pinky and thumb together, while holding your palm facing up, and flex the hand upwards. If 1 tendon is standing out more than the others that's palmaris longus.

I know a cool one... when you have heart disease and your arteries fill up with plaque most people have a heart attack and die without treatment (bypass surgery). Some peoples hearts produce collaterals which are new blood vessels that route blood flow around these blockages protecting the heart from damage due to lack of blood flow (this is called ischemia). So some peoples body's naturally bypass on their own...they still don't know why some people have this ability or why others don't....the human body is fascinating!
